Jagadamba Mall is a renowned social worker, a noted scholar, a columnist, an orator and an author. Since 1976, he has spent five decades to exploring and researching North East, residing in Kohima, Dimapur and other parts of the region. He has toured extensively and frequently across Nagaland, Manipur and all the NE states, including Sikkim. He was also an officer in Office of Accountant General (A&E) Nagaland, Kohima. He writes in Hindi and English. He knows Bangla, Assamese and Nagamese. Born in Machharihwa village, Deoria district, UP, he holds a degree of B.Sc. (Biology) from Gorakhpur University. He now lives in Gorakhpur. His field of socio-cultural activity is Northeast region including Sikkim as a worker of Vanvasi Kalyan Ashram with his headquarters at Guwahati.
